Understanding Dragon Naturally Speaking

Dragon Naturally Speaking, developed by Nuance Communications, is a sophisticated speech recognition software that converts spoken words into text. Originally launched in 1997, it has undergone extensive development to improve its capabilities. The software is utilized by a variety of users, including professionals, casual users, and those with disabilities. It enables hands-free typing, voice commands, and even complex voice commands to control different applications on a computer.

Key Factors Influencing Accuracy

  1. User Training: Dragon Naturally Speaking learns and adapts to an individual’s voice and speaking style over time. The more a user practices and trains the software, the more accurate it becomes.

  2. Accent and Dialect: The software includes settings for different accents, but some users may still find discrepancies based on regional dialects. The training phase allows for improvement in recognizing specific accents.

  3. Microphone Quality: Using a high-quality microphone can drastically impact the accuracy of the software. Standard computer microphones might not capture speech with the same clarity as professional-grade options.

  4. Environments and Background Noise: The presence of background noise can disrupt voice recognition. Quiet environments significantly enhance accuracy compared to bustling or noisy areas.

  5. Content Complexity: The nature of the content being dictated plays a role as well. Technical jargon or complex vocabulary may require prior customization of the software.

Real-World Accuracy: How Precise Is Dragon Naturally Speaking?

In real-world applications, users often report varying levels of accuracy. Studies and user testimonials have indicated that Dragon Naturally Speaking achieves an accuracy rate of up to 99% with properly trained setups in ideal conditions. However, accuracy can fluctuate depending on the factors mentioned earlier.

Maximizing Your Accuracy with Dragon Naturally Speaking

To achieve the highest level of accuracy possible with Dragon Naturally Speaking, users can follow several tips:

Implementing Best Practices

  1. Complete the Initial Training: Spend time completing the software’s training module. This process helps the program learn your voice and speech patterns, which enhances accuracy.

  2. Use a Quality Microphone: Invest in a premium microphone that can effectively capture your voice. A USB microphone or a headset designed for voice recognition can be beneficial.

  3. Speak Clearly and Steadily: Maintain a moderate pace and enunciate words clearly to produce better transcription results.

  4. Minimize Background Noise: Choose a quiet environment for dictation. Avoid situations where other voices or loud noises might disrupt the software’s comprehension.

Customizing Vocabulary

Customizing the vocabulary is key to enhancing accuracy:

  • Add Specific Terms: Familiarize yourself with the software’s features that allow you to add jargon or specialized terminology related to your profession or interests.

  • Using Context: Take advantage of the capability to adapt the dictionary based on your frequently used words and phrases.

How does Dragon Naturally Speaking improve its accuracy over time?

Dragon Naturally Speaking utilizes a feature called “voice training” that allows the software to learn an individual user’s speech patterns. When users spend time training the software with their voice, it helps the system become more familiar with accents, pronunciation, and even specific phrases. This personalization process is integral to enhancing accuracy as users dictate more frequently.

Additionally, Dragon has built-in capabilities for adapting to changes in a user’s voice. If a user experiences a cold or unexpected vocal changes, Dragon can recalibrate its recognition parameters to maintain accuracy. This continuous learning process makes the software robust and enables it to remain effective over time, accommodating various vocal nuances.

Can Dragon Naturally Speaking be used for multiple languages?

Yes, Dragon Naturally Speaking supports multiple languages, including English, Spanish, French, German, and more. Users can choose their preferred language during installation, allowing the software to recognize and interpret commands and dictation appropriately. This multilingual capability is beneficial for non-English speakers or those who work in environments where multiple languages are used.

However, it’s important to note that each language version may have its own accuracy levels, vocabulary sets, and features. Users switching between languages might need to switch the model in the software, as the speech recognition algorithms are specifically tailored for each language to maximize performance.
